Subject: Annual Billing — Decision Needed

Team,

Moving Fablerock customers to annual billing would pull roughly nine weeks of cash forward and cut invoicing overhead by a third. Churn risk is modest per the Ostwick pilot. I want sign-off by Thursday so legal can revise terms. The strategic reasoning is summarised in the note below.

management briefing: Headcount on the Ralix team goes from 9 to 140 by the end of January. Gross margin on Ralix came in at 10 percent against a plan of 20 percent.

## Deployment

The Emberledger loyalty-points service deploys through a staged pipeline: build, migration check, canary, then full rollout. Before promoting, verify ledger checksums match between canary and stable, and confirm no pending balance migrations remain. Rollbacks are safe only before the migration step completes. Once promoted, the service starts with the configuration values listed below.

settings of tagef-bawif:
DRUIX_HOST=druix.zemvarlabs.internal
DRUIX_PORT=8000

## Authentication

The consent banner rollout for Bannerly requires each deploy job to authenticate against the Consentrix preference service before writing region-specific banner configurations. Please verify during review that the client only reads the credential from the environment at startup and never logs it, even at debug level. The retry wrapper must also strip the auth header from error payloads. For local verification against the staging instance, use the key that follows.

service key, fawip-bajef: kto11_Qt5wZK9vdNC

## Runbook: Pinquill address autocomplete widget

If suggestion latency exceeds 400ms or the widget returns empty results for valid prefixes, restart the suggestion cache first. Do not redeploy during business hours. Check the geo-index rebuild job finished overnight; a partial index causes truncated results. Before escalating, confirm the widget is running with the expected settings shown below.

service settings:
PRAIX_LOG_LEVEL=error
PRAIX_METRICS_HOST=metrics.praix.qorvelcorp.corp
PRAIX_POOL_SIZE=16